Прокладываем маршруты.
Иногда приходится указывать на карте или схеме не просто маршрут туристического путешествия, а обозначать и направление движения. Такая необходимость может появиться и при проведении каких-либо спортивных соревнований, например, различных марафонов, да и просто для определения маршрутов прогулок. То есть, приходится обозначать направление движения равномерно расположенными стрелками.
К Corel такой маршрут проложить можно за пару минут.
Импортируем в программу фрагмент отсканированной карты центра Москвы.
Активируем инструменты «кривая Безье» или свободное рисование и обрисовываем маршрут нашей прогулки. Выбираем контрастный, хорошо заметный цвет и толщину абриса. При необходимости корректируем кривую инструментом «Форма».
Рис.1. Инструментом «кривая Безье» обрисован маршрут.
Если просто задать наконечники, то они появятся только в начале и в конце нарисованной кривой. Этого недостаточно, если требуется расставить стрелки на протяжении всего маршрута.
Для наглядности в окне «Свойства объекта» с помощью однородной прозрачности немного «приглушаем» изображение карты.
Рис.2. К фоновому изображению карты применен эффект прозрачности.
Попробуем использовать эффект «перетекание». Стрелку можно нарисовать «с нуля» или перетащить на рабочий стол из окна «вставка символа», выбрав нужный рисунок из символьного шрифта.
Рис.3. Стрелки выбраны в окне «Вставка символа».
Создаем копию стрелки и применяем перетекание. Располагаем группу перетекания вдоль пути.
Рис.4. Результат применения эффекта перетекания.
Даже при включении режимов «перетекание вдоль пути» и «повернуть объекты», стрелки расположены неверно. Можно попробовать различные варианты настроек эффекта, переместить центры вращения опорных объектов, но все равно нужный результат не будет достигнут. Разве что, если разъединить группу эффекта перетекания, разгруппировать все объекты и вручную поворачивать каждую стрелку, ориентируя ее в нужном направлении.
Рис.5. Результат эффекта перетекания после изменения центра вращения опорных объектов.
Для достижения результата необходимо разделить кривую на отдельные фрагменты и присвоить всем фрагментам начальный или конечный наконечники той или иной формы.
Попробуем применить эффект перетекания, используя не стрелки, а небольшие окружности, диаметром чуть больше абриса основного пути.
Применяем эффект перетекания и располагаем окружности вдоль пути.
Рис.6. Результат эффекта перетекания окружностей вдоль пути.
Выделяем группу перетекания, разъединяем ее командой меню «Объект» > «Разъединить группу перетекания». Разгруппировываем полностью все объекты перетекания – опорные и промежуточные и перегруппировываем их заново. Все окружности расположены на переднем плане, опорн6ый путь – маршрут находится на план ниже. Выделяем путь и окружности и применяем команду формирования «задние минус передние». Практически происходит вырезание из кривой- маршрута фрагментов в форме окружностей. Кривая разделена на отдельные отрезки.
Если величина отрезков непринципиальна, то можно и вручную разделить кривую, используя инструменты «нож» или «ластик», однако если длина кривой значительна и стрелки должны быть распределены равномерно, то лучше использовать разделение с помощью перетекания окружностей.
Рис.7. Результат эффекта перетекания окружностей вдоль пути.
Рис.8. Основной путь разделен на фрагменты.
Остается только выбрать стиль линии для обозначения маршрута и определить наконечники.
Рис.9. Для абриса выбран стиль линии и тип наконечника.
Рис.10. В любой момент все параметры абриса можно изменить.
В окне «Свойства объекта» легко открыть вкладку «Кривая» и посмотреть свойства этой кривой. В этом же окне можно узнать и длину кривой. Пересчитав длину линии в соответствии с масштабом карты можно получить приблизительную длину указанного маршрута.
Рис.11. Маршрут путешествия можно нанести и на фотографию.